When Are Roses the Best Valentine’s Choice?

Roses have long been associated with deep romantic love. Their elegant form and exquisite fragrance make them a favorite for Valentine’s Day. If you and your partner have shared many anniversaries or significant milestones, roses can perfectly encapsulate the depth and continuity of your affection.

Not just limited to red, roses come in many colors, each carrying different meanings. Pink roses convey admiration and sweetness, perfect for newer relationships where you wish to express appreciation without overwhelming intensity. White roses symbolize purity and can represent the fresh, sincere emotions of a budding romance.

Choosing Based on Relationship Stage

Your stage of relationship can greatly influence the type of floral arrangement that would be most poignant. In the early stages, a mixed bouquet serves as a light-hearted gesture that communicates interest and attraction, without the full-force intensity of red roses.

For those who have navigated through various phases together, choosing roses can help reaffirm love and dedication. Particularly during Valentine's, romantic flower arrangements like a dozen red roses have a timeless allure that can both surprise and delight.

What colors are most romantic for Valentine’s flowers?

While red remains the quintessential color of love, don’t overlook the potential of pinks, whites, and even purples for expressing admiration, purity, and enchantment. Match the colors with your partner’s favorites for a more personal touch.
